草庐IT

C++实验

全部标签

H3C配置多区域OSPF实验

一、先上拓扑:二、实验环境:Windows10(21H1),HCL版本:V3.0.1(华三模拟器)三、实验需求:        SWA、SWB、SWC、SWD都运行OSPF,并将整个自治系统划分为3个区域。其中Switch A和Switch B作为ABR来转发区域之间的路由。配置完成后,每台交换机都应学到AS内的到所有网段的路由。    四、简介:    拓扑中设备间除了设备与设备之间互连的接口是同网段外,其他接口均不在同一段,如果不配置任何路由条目,当前拓扑中两台PC是无法互相通讯的。但写静态路由会比较麻烦,尤其是设备较多的情况,静态路由显得不再方便,本实验通过在各个设备上运行OSPF尝试使

实验十五 摩尔状态机序列检测器“1101”

实验十五摩尔状态机序列检测器按键消抖模块debounce_button:由于实际的拨码开关和按键开关都是机械式的设备,开关动作来回抖动多次后才能稳定下来,这个过程就会使得信号产生==抖动==。因此,如果用按键来产生时钟信号,为了==一次按键得到一次上升沿(或下降沿)==,那么需要对按键输入先进行==消抖处理==。并转串模块parallel_serial:运用并转串输出模块,将==八个拨码开关==作为外部二进制码流的输入。用一个按键作为一个启动检测信号,另用一个按键来模拟clk信号,检测开关序列中是否存在“1101”序列,按下启动检测信号后,每按一次模拟clk的按键便==传入一个开关的值==,这

C#网络应用编程,实验2:IP地址转换和域名解析练习

文章目录实验2:IP地址转换和域名解析练习1、创建一个WPF应用程序项目2、将App.xaml中的Application.Resources节内容改为3、修改MainWindow.xaml及代码隐藏类4、用鼠标右键单击项目,选择【添加】-【新建文件夹】命令,在项目中添加一个名为Examples的文件夹。5、用鼠标右键单击Examples文件夹,选择【添加】-【页】命令,在该文件夹下添加一个名为Page1.xaml的页。之后再按同样方法添加页Page2.xaml和Page3.xaml。6、修改Page1.xaml的核心代码Page1.cs结果实验2:IP地址转换和域名解析练习1.通过本实验,复习

C#网络应用编程,实验2:IP地址转换和域名解析练习

文章目录实验2:IP地址转换和域名解析练习1、创建一个WPF应用程序项目2、将App.xaml中的Application.Resources节内容改为3、修改MainWindow.xaml及代码隐藏类4、用鼠标右键单击项目,选择【添加】-【新建文件夹】命令,在项目中添加一个名为Examples的文件夹。5、用鼠标右键单击Examples文件夹,选择【添加】-【页】命令,在该文件夹下添加一个名为Page1.xaml的页。之后再按同样方法添加页Page2.xaml和Page3.xaml。6、修改Page1.xaml的核心代码Page1.cs结果实验2:IP地址转换和域名解析练习1.通过本实验,复习

数据库实验2---数据查询

数据查询实验内容实验要求实验步骤及处理结果思考体会参考资料实验内容在studentsdb数据库中使用SELECT语句进行基本查询。(1)在student_info表中,查询每个学生的学号、姓名、出生日期信息。(2)查询student_info表学号为0002的学生的姓名和家庭住址。(3)查询student_info表所有出生日期在95年以后的女同学的姓名和出生日期。使用select语句进行条件查询。(1)在grade表中查询分数在70-80范围内的学生的学号、课程编号和成绩。(2)在grade表中查询课程编号为0002的学生的平均成绩。(3)在grade表中查询选修课程编号为0003的人数和该

数据库实验2---数据查询

数据查询实验内容实验要求实验步骤及处理结果思考体会参考资料实验内容在studentsdb数据库中使用SELECT语句进行基本查询。(1)在student_info表中,查询每个学生的学号、姓名、出生日期信息。(2)查询student_info表学号为0002的学生的姓名和家庭住址。(3)查询student_info表所有出生日期在95年以后的女同学的姓名和出生日期。使用select语句进行条件查询。(1)在grade表中查询分数在70-80范围内的学生的学号、课程编号和成绩。(2)在grade表中查询课程编号为0002的学生的平均成绩。(3)在grade表中查询选修课程编号为0003的人数和该

CSAPP Shell Lab 实验报告

前言:强烈建议先看完csapp第八章再做此实验,完整的tsh.c代码贴在文章末尾了1.准备知识进程的概念、状态以及控制进程的几个函数(fork,waitpid,execve)。信号的概念,会编写正确安全的信号处理程序。shell的概念,理解shell程序是如何利用进程管理和信号去执行一个命令行语句。2.实验目的shelllab主要目的是为了熟悉进程控制和信号。具体来说需要比对16个test和rtest文件的输出,实现七个函数:voideval(char*cmdline):分析命令,并派生子进程执行主要功能是解析cmdline并运行intbuiltin_cmd(char**argv):解析和执行

国防科技大学|信息化保障和支援能力训练虚拟仿真实验

目录一、理论与实践课程1.课程简介2.课程内容3.教学目标4.课程特色解读二、教学团队​国防科技大学承担着“军队联合作战保障人才”的培养任务,遵循“以战领教”的人才培养导向,为此,国防科技大学联合头歌平台建设了《信息化保障和支援能力训练虚拟仿真实验课程》,为学员打造“战中学”、“战中练”的虚仿实验课堂,帮助学员打通从课堂到战场的最后一公里。本课程凭借沉浸式的虚拟军事任务场景、全面综合的技术知识等优势,在头歌的全力支持下成功申报湖南省虚拟仿真实验教学一流课程。课程已开启第四期(2021年9月13日-2022年1月3日)学习,累计已有7635人报名学习,欢迎各界学习者前来体验! 一、理论与实践课程

计算机组成原理3个实验-logisim实现“七段数码管”、“有限状态机控制的8*8位乘法器”、“单周期MIPS CPU设计”。

目录标题1.首先是七段数码管  标题二:有限状态机控制的8*8位乘法器标题三:单周期MIPSCPU设计标题1.首先是七段数码管 1看一下实验要求:  2.接下来就是详细设计:1.组合逻辑设计    由于7段数码管由7个发光的数码管构成,因为我们想用二进制将0-9这几个数字表示出来。所以他需要4位数字才能够把这7个数码管表示的数字都囊括其中,这7位输出来控制发光二极管来显示数字0~9。首先先列出七段数码管显示的数字:由此可见,例如:当想要输出零这个数字时,除了g这段数码管不亮以外,其他的数码管都要亮,以此类推,我们用二进制表示要输出的数字,比如0001那就是要输出1,0010就是要输出2。由此我

数据结构实验五:哈夫曼树的设计及实现

实验五 哈夫曼树的设计及实现一、实验目的1.掌握哈夫曼树的构造算法,理解二叉树的应用;2.掌握哈夫曼编码的构造算法。二、实验内容输入一串字符串,根据给定的字符串中字符出现的频率建立相应的哈夫曼树,构造哈夫曼编码表,在此基础上可以对压缩文件进行压缩(即编码)。已知字符串中出现的字符为A、B、C、D、E、F、G、H,其相应的权值为7、19、2、6、32、3、21、10。三、实验提示此实验内容即要求实现主教材的案例5.1,具体实现可参考算法5.10和算法5.11。首先,读入一行字符串,统计每个字符出现的频率;然后,根据字符出现的频率利用算法5.10建立相应的哈夫曼树;最后,根据得到的哈夫曼树利用算法